首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Emacs未填充终端帧缓冲区

Emacs是一款功能强大的文本编辑器,被广泛用于软件开发和其他文本处理任务中。它具有丰富的功能和高度可定制性,可以通过插件和配置文件来满足不同用户的需求。

终端帧缓冲区是指终端显示器上用于存储和显示图像的内存区域。在Emacs中,未填充终端帧缓冲区是指终端显示器上还没有被Emacs填充内容的部分。当Emacs在终端中运行时,它会将文本和图像渲染到终端帧缓冲区中,然后显示在终端上。

Emacs未填充终端帧缓冲区可能是由于以下几种情况导致的:

  1. 刚启动Emacs:当你刚启动Emacs时,终端帧缓冲区可能是空白的,因为还没有任何内容被填充进去。
  2. 执行清屏操作:在终端中执行清屏操作(如Ctrl+L)会清空终端帧缓冲区,导致之前的内容被清除。
  3. 窗口尺寸调整:如果你调整了终端窗口的尺寸,终端帧缓冲区的大小也会相应改变,可能会导致未填充的区域出现。

对于Emacs未填充终端帧缓冲区的问题,可以尝试以下解决方法:

  1. 刷新终端:可以尝试刷新终端,重新绘制终端帧缓冲区,以填充空白区域。可以使用终端的刷新命令(如clear)或者重启终端来实现。
  2. 调整窗口尺寸:尝试调整终端窗口的尺寸,使终端帧缓冲区的大小与终端窗口大小相匹配,以填充未填充的区域。
  3. 检查配置文件和插件:有时,Emacs的配置文件或插件可能会导致终端帧缓冲区的显示问题。可以尝试禁用或更新相关的配置文件或插件,以解决问题。

需要注意的是,由于Emacs是一个文本编辑器,它的主要功能是编辑文本而不是直接操作终端帧缓冲区。因此,解决终端帧缓冲区的问题可能需要对终端和操作系统的相关知识有一定的了解。如果问题仍然存在,建议查阅Emacs的官方文档或寻求相关技术支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券